% [.y Enclosure L Special Report No.90-002, Units 1 and 2 i Volume Of Water in Both Fire Protection Vater Storage Tanks Less Than The Technical Specification Limit  ;

r.

1 I

V' - At.0959 on. January 25,.1990, thu vater level in both fire protection water storage tanks was observed 19 he below the level required to meet-Technical Specification 3.7.11.1. i short time earlier, a section of the fire j i

- protection systeni yard main had ruptured which-resulted in the level in both fire protection water storage tanks decreasing below the required. )

minimum level. The_ rupture was promptly. isolated and level in the tanks increasad above the minimum value at 1150 on January 25, 1990. The minimum ,

observed level in the. tanks was 23 and one half feet while the required i

? - minimum level is 26 feet. There was no effect on the fire protection i capability for any safety related equipment.

- The affected section of pipe vill be replaced. Since the cause of the~

rupture was not readily apparent, the pipe vill be evaluated;to determine ,

the'cause of failure.

- For,this event, Technical Specification 3.7.11.1 requires the'following Special Reports: a) notification by_ telephone within 24 hours2.777778e-4 days <br />0.00667 hours <br />3.968254e-5 weeks <br />9.132e-6 months <br />; b) .

confirmation by telegraph, mailgram or Escsimile no later-than the next vorking day; and c) in writing within 14 days following the event.

Telephone notification was made on January _25,i1990-and a facsimile report was transmitted on January 26, 1990. ThisLSpecial Report completes,the-notification requirements of Technical Specification 3.7.11.1.- r t
